1
by Reece, Jane B.
Published 2017
2
3
by Campbell, Neil A.
Published 2005
Other Authors: '; ...Reece, Jane B....
4
by Campbell, Neil A.
Published 2000
Other Authors: '; ...Reece, Jane B....
5
by Campbell, Neil A.
Published 2003
Other Authors: '; ...Reece, Jane B....
6
Other Authors: '; ...Reece, Jane B....
7
Other Authors: '; ...Reece, Jane B....